Conquering Debt: Actionable Steps to Financial Wellness
Taking control of your finances can feel overwhelming, but it's a journey well worth undertaking. Start your path to financial wellness by creating a detailed budget that records your revenue and expenses. This will give you a clear understanding of where your money is going and expose areas where you can trim spending.
- Look into debt management options to simplify your payments and potentially lower interest rates.
- Negotiate with creditors to ask for lower monthly payments or eliminate certain fees.
- Prioritize paying down high-interest debt first, as this will save you money in the long run.
Remember, tackling debt is a marathon, not a sprint. Be patient with yourself, celebrate your successes, and don't be afraid to find professional advice when needed.
Mastering Your Money: A Budgeting Guide
Taking charge of your finances can seem daunting, but it doesn't have to be. Begin by creating a budget that records your income and expenses. This will give you a clear picture of where your money is going and identify areas where you can potentially save.
- Use budgeting apps or spreadsheets to simplify the process.
- Set realistic financial goals, both short-term and long-term.
- Prioritize essential expenses and cut back on non-essential spending.
By sticking with your budget consistently, you'll be well on your way to achieving financial stability and accomplishing your goals. Remember, budgeting is a journey, not a destination, so be patient and modify your plan as needed.
